First Springsteen mention that comes to mind is the "all-set Cobra Jet" in Open All Night. But that's just an engine. Probably in a late 60s Mustang(?), but he never actually says so. Born to Run is even less specific. You do get "skeleton frames of burned out Chevrolets" in Thunder Road and "the bumper of a state trooper's Ford" in Darlington County. Buicks in My Hometown and Highway Patrolman, a Dodge in Jungleland, a Chevy in Racing In the Street.
